Step-by-step explanation:

Given  : If the equation of a circle is (x + 5)² + (y - 7)² = 36.

To find : Find its center .

Solution : We have given (x + 5)² + (y - 7)² = 36.

Standard equation of circle : (x – h)² + (y – k)² = r².

Where, (h ,k) = center , r =  radius .

On comparing (x + 5)² + (y - 7)² = 36.

h = -5 , k = 7

So, the center ( -5 , 7).
